Wine Advocate 92 - top Pessimist ever:

 

The 2021 Pessimist is a blend of 75% Petite Sirah, 10% Syrah, 11% Zinfandel, 2% Lagrein and 2% Malbec matured for 10 months in 60% new French oak. It has an opaque ruby-purple color and lush scents of cassis, blueberry jam, violet, lavender and hints of powdered sugar. The full-bodied palate is supple and fresh with gently candied fruits and a satisfying finish. This will be a crowd-pleaser.
